什麼是 C++ 中的字串字面值?
在程式設計中的字串字面值或匿名字串用來表示原始碼中的字串值。通俗來說,字串字面值就是雙引號之間的文字。例如,
const char* var = "Hello";
在此對 var 的定義中,“Hello”是字串字面值。以此方式使用 const 表示你可以使用 var 訪問該字串而不能對其進行更改。C++ 編譯器將以處理字元陣列的方式處理它。
廣告
在程式設計中的字串字面值或匿名字串用來表示原始碼中的字串值。通俗來說,字串字面值就是雙引號之間的文字。例如,
const char* var = "Hello";
在此對 var 的定義中,“Hello”是字串字面值。以此方式使用 const 表示你可以使用 var 訪問該字串而不能對其進行更改。C++ 編譯器將以處理字元陣列的方式處理它。